Machang Bridge and Changwon Himchan Hospital Provide 10 Million Won in Surgery Support for Low-Income Patients
Supporting Surgery Costs for Neighbors in Need for 5 Years
Machang Bridge donated 10 million won on the 28th to Changwon Himchan Hospital to support surgery costs for low-income groups.
With this donation, they have been supporting joint and spine surgery costs for vulnerable groups in Gyeongnam Province for five years.
At the donation ceremony held at the 10th-floor education center of Changwon Himchan Hospital, Machang Bridge CEO Kim Seonghwan, Changwon Himchan Hospital Director Lee Sanghoon, and related personnel attended. They shared the status of the previous donation usage and progress reports of the project, and had a discussion to maintain mutual development and an organic cooperative relationship between the two organizations.
Starting with 5 million won in 2019, Machang Bridge increased the amount from 2020 and has donated 10 million won annually, delivering a total of 45 million won to Changwon Himchan Hospital including this year's donation.
Changwon Himchan Hospital selects low-income individuals in the region who need knee artificial joint surgery and spinal screw fixation surgery, supporting up to 1 million won per surgery case. This year, 10 people have received actual surgery cost support benefits.
CEO Kim of Machang Bridge said, “I hope the donated funds become a warm support for the medically marginalized groups,” and added, “We will cherish our relationship with the hospital to continue this happy partnership.”
Director Lee said, “As the year-end approaches, I thank Machang Bridge for their annual generosity toward neighbors in need. As medical technology advances, treatment costs increase, so we will use the donated funds for the region’s marginalized groups with care and meaning.”

Meanwhile, Machang Bridge’s major shareholder is Macquarie Korea Infrastructure Investment Company (MKIF), which actively participates in ESG (Environmental, Social, Governance) activities focusing on environmental protection, social contribution, and transparent governance. In particular, it strives to maintain the road in optimal condition for the convenience of residents, prevent industrial accidents, and promote mutual development with the local community.
